Ingredients

Each capsule contains Turmeric Extract (Curcuma longa): 500 mg from 400 mg BCM-95™ extract (25:1) with 380 mg curcuminoids, plus 100 mg whole organic turmeric extract with 5 mg curcuminoids. Other Ingredients: Brown rice flour, magnesium stearate, silicon dioxide.

Allergens

This product contains curcumin and other natural ingredients. Individuals with hypersensitivity to curcumin or any components of the formulation should avoid use. Always check the ingredient list for potential allergens and consult a healthcare professional if you have concerns.

Warnings

This product may cause hypersensitivity reactions to curcumin or other ingredients. It is not recommended for use during pregnancy or breastfeeding. Consult a healthcare provider before using with sulfasalazine, anticoagulants, antiplatelet medications, or antidiabetic medications.

Directions

Adults and children over 12 years: First week: Take 2 capsules daily with food. After the first week: Take 1 to 2 capsules daily with food, or as advised by your healthcare professional.
